The Whispering Warnings Your Eyes Send
Dry eye rarely shouts—it whispers. Frequent stinging, mucus strings, light sensitivity, and trouble driving at night all suggest an unstable tear film. If you blink often yet your vision still fluctuates, the cornea may be crying out for help. A trusted Coal City optometrist can spot these subtleties long before vision drops. Left alone, the surface can scar, infection risk climbs, and reading comfort plummets. Early attention means shorter recovery, fewer prescriptions, and happier mornings.
Why Expert Guidance Changes Everything
Many folks rotate drug-store drops for months, searching for that “perfect” bottle. Meanwhile, inflammation keeps simmering. A seasoned partner pinpoints the cause—poor tear quality, eyelid dysfunction, medications, hormones—and tailors therapy instead of guessing. A quick chat with a Bourbonnais eye doctor often uncovers lifestyle tweaks that make an immediate difference. Alongside targeted heat masks and prescription-strength lubricants, you might learn that upgrading your work monitor or adding omega-3s saves future headaches. A brief consult can spare years of trial and frustration.
